Why Youâll Love Eating Ezekiel Bread
- Higher Nutrient Content: Sprouting activates enzymes and breaks down antinutrients, boosting absorption of iron, zinc, B vitamins, and antioxidants.
- More Sustainable Energy: The slow-digesting complex carbs and additional fiber help stabilize blood sugarâideal for lasting morning energy without midwatch crashes.
- Better Digestibility: The long fermentation process pre-digests gluten and phytic acid, making it gentler on sensitive stomachs.
- Versatile Breakfast Base: Serve it plain with avocado, top with nut butter and banana, or toast with eggs for a wholesome meal that keeps you full longer.

đŸ Easy Homemade Ezekiel Bread (Active Sourdough Base)
Makes about 1 loaf | ~4 servings | 24 hours prep + fermentation
Ingredients:
- 1 cup sprouted whole grain flour mix (e.g., wheat, barley, oats, alfalfa, spelt)
- 1 cup all-purpose flour (or 100% whole wheat flour)
- 1 tsp active sourdough starter (or yogurt)
- 1 tsp sea salt
- 1 tsp apple cider vinegar
- 1 tbsp compromised raw honey or maple syrup (for fermentation kick)
- 3/4 cup warm water (about 110°F / 45°C)
Instructions:
- Combine flours: In a large bowl, mix sprouted whole grain flour, all-purpose flour, salt, vinegar, and honey.
- Add starter & water: Stir in sourdough starter and warm water. Mix into a shaggy dough. Cover and refrigerate overnight (12+ hours) for full fermentationâthis flavor boosts nutritional benefits.
- Shape loaf: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C). Lightly flour a baking dish. Gently shape dough into a tight round or oven-safe bowl.
- Final rise: Cover and rise 1â2 hours at room temperature. Preshaping before baking ensures even baking.
- Bake: Bake 30â35 minutes until golden brown and firm. Let cool slightly before slicing.
